Pennsylvania Kid Wind Challenge Workshop 

Pennsylvania KidWind is an engineering design challenge that engages students in wind energy. Teams of 1-5 students from grades 4-12 design and build small-scale wind turbines to test their power output and present on their turbine design at one of the regional competition centers (PSU Greater Allegheny, PSU Hazleton, and a Centre County region TBD) in order to qualify for the Pennsylvania state competition on March 29, 2023, at Penn State University Park.
